MEMO — Branch Managers

The Trellick 400 line is retired effective end of quarter. Stop reorders now. Remaining stock moves to clearance pricing per the schedule from head office. Service parts stay available for two years; warranty handling is unchanged. Route customer questions to the regional desk, not to press or partners. Do not speculate publicly on replacements. The reason for the timing is strategic and restricted. See the confidential note appended below this memo.

board note of kageg-bahof: The renewal with Holwynax Holdings closes at $2 million a year, 5 percent below the last contract. Project Ulaath slips by two quarters because of the supplier delay.

Release checklist — GreenLoft controller, sensor drift step. Before shipping firmware to any grow bay, run the 24-hour drift soak on the humidity and CO2 probes in the Calverton test rack. Drift over 2% triggers automatic recalibration; over 5% means the probe gets swapped, not tuned. Log both pre- and post-soak readings in the drift sheet. Do not skip the soak even if the probes passed last cycle — thermal cycling resets nothing. Record results against the firmware build token shown below.

session token of yajof-bagef = htk4_937d

This PR extends the Quillbrook bounce processor to distinguish hard bounces from transient deferrals. Hard bounces now suppress the recipient immediately; soft bounces increment a rolling counter and only suppress after repeated failures within the decay window. I've verified behavior against the staging mail sink and added regression tests for malformed DSN payloads. Before approving the release, please review the tuning constants below.

tuning table, tajeg-tafop:
PRIORITIES = {
    "ralion": 695,
    "ruswyn": 224,
}

## Profile Store Sharding — Release Notes

Northwell's user-profile store splits across 16 shards keyed by account hash. Migrations run shard-by-shard; never promote a build mid-migration. Release manager owns the cutover checklist: freeze writes, verify replication lag under 2s, then flip the router. Rollbacks require the previous shard map snapshot. Deploys to the shard coordinators are authenticated with the key below.

signing key of bagap-yawep = bky13_TbfT6ZMUoGJo2